Contestants of the U.S. Army 2016 Best Warrior Competition wrapped up Day Two by conducting a day and night land navigation course, Sept 27, 2016, at Fort A.P. Hill, Va. The BWC is an annual weeklong event that will test 20 Soldiers from 10 major commands on their physical and mental capabilities. The top NCO and top Soldier will be announced Oct. 3, in Washington DC.
